A main air conditioner cools air in one spot prior to distributing it throughout the house utilizing the heating system’s air handling capabil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ly tiny areas and require lots of units to cool the whole home.
The majority of single-family homes in the United States with central air conditioning utilize a split system. This suggests that the gadget is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within your home and a compressor exterior.

Your specialist will assist you in identifying the appropriate size central air conditioning conditioner for your house. A system that is too little will run almost constantly, whereas a unit that is too big will chill the house too rapidly and turn off before completing a complete c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ter scenario is taxing on the system. It can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from flowing. As a result, a huge air conditioner may be less effective at cooling than a smaller sized unit.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a computation referred to as a “Manual-J” to determine the very best unit for your home. This will consider all of the criteria we’ve mentioned and more, resulting in the most precise size possible.
However, we understand that many house owners like to have a general idea of what size they require ahead of time. Here’s a rough estimate of central air conditioner size: To get the Btu required, increase the square video footage of your house’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to get the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is simply a basic quote, and there are a number of factors. If your home’s first flooring has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Rates differ based upon the local market and the job details, as with any considerable job. For labor and materials, a typical split system main air installation using an existing heater could c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that expense will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for majority of it.
